Leah Schuette


Ambrosia

Ambrosia is the nectar of the gods, it brings longevity and strength to those who drink it. I built the basics of a wine brand and illustrated five labels for five types of wine this brand would sell. In this collection of wine illustrated labels I focused on a connection with nature, considering the symbiotic relationship between people and trees. Growing up in the Adirondacks near a nature preserve, I have developed a great appreciation for the environment and conservation. Keeping in mind these ideas of nature and interconnection I created Ambrosia.

I started out with the image of a tree to represent the company's ties to the environment. Trees are often symbols of life, growth, and prosperity. My trees are modeled off of Bonsai trees, which reflects not only harmony between humans and nature, but the time and dedication that went into creating the illustrations. I chose the palettes for each label based on the flavors that can be found in each of the wines.


Bio

Leah Schuette is a digital artist with a focus in advertising, editorial, and surface design illustration. Through her senior year at the Maine College of Art & Design she developed a love for patterning and product design. Based in Upstate New York surrounded by nature, Leah used saturated colors and natural themes that remind her of growing up in the woods.
